The short version
Above-average SATs results. 88% capacity. Rated Good by Ofsted (2023).
- SATs results are above the national average, with 71% meeting the expected standard (national: 62%)
- Rated Good by Ofsted in 2023
- 49%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, above the national average

Attendance
In practice: Pupils miss about 13 days per year on average — nearly a month of school.
22% of pupils miss 10% or more of school
2% of pupils miss half or more of school sessions
Source: DfE School Census
Staffing
On average, 19 pupils share each qualified teacher, but with teaching assistants there's 1 adult for every 9 pupils.

Questions parents ask
What is Francis Askew Primary School's Ofsted rating?
Francis Askew Primary School was rated Good at its most recent inspection in April 2023. Full reports are linked on this page.
How many pupils attend Francis Askew Primary School?
Francis Askew Primary School currently has 371 pupils on roll, according to the latest Department for Education data.
What ages does Francis Askew Primary School take?
Francis Askew Primary School caters for pupils aged 3 to 11. It is classified as a primary school.
Where is Francis Askew Primary School?
Francis Askew Primary School is in Hull, HU4 6LQ, in the Kingston upon Hull, City of local authority area. The map on this page shows the exact location and nearby schools.
Does Francis Askew Primary School have a sixth form?
No, Francis Askew Primary School does not have a sixth form. Pupils move to a different school or college for post-16 study.
